Why You Should Have Mold Inspections Done
There are many places a home can get mold. This includes behind walls, beneath floors, the attic and poorly ventilated areas such as bathrooms and basements. Funds can be lost, and in most cases, mold will keep expanding without detection. This is what makes it important to get routine inspections.
Mold is more than just a stain or an odor. Mold can cause serious health problems including respiratory problems, allergies, and other problems that may arise, particularly in kids and older people, or people with a weakened immune system. Therefore, you should remove mold as soon as you find it.
Mold can also cause more issues to your house over time. Mold can rot wood, cause structural issues, and destroy paint, wallpaper, and even the foundation. Mold can also be contained and eliminated with proper treatments.
How Mold Inspections Work
This usually means an assessor coming in and checking potential mold growing areas in your home. At Northern Kentucky Inspections, we are thorough and meticulous, so you can be sure we won’t miss any mold.
Here’s an example of what you might expect to see in a mold inspection. The first stage is a consultation in which you will be asked questions regarding things that will help the inspector diagnose a problem, such as, “Is there a musty smell in your home?” or questions that address possible mold formations, like “Are there spots on your walls?” or “Are there areas that feel damp?”
Visual Inspection: Our team checks out mold prone areas such as attics, basements, bathrooms, kitchens, and crawl spaces. We look for signs of mold or things that encourage mold growth, like leaks or signs of water damage.
Moisture Evaluation: We determine and trace hidden moisture in walls, ceilings, and floors. Understanding the moisture condition helps in the early mold detection.
Air Quality Testing: We test for mold spores in the air as part of the air quality tests. This helps us locate mold that may not be visually obvious.
Detailed Report: Following the inspection, you’ll receive a thorough report that lists your inspection findings, including any discovered mold, at risk areas, and your options for treatment, remediation, or both. We’ll make it as clear as possible so you can take the necessary actions.

FAQs
1.How often should I get a mold inspection?
Once every two years is a good general rule, but if you see any signs of mold like a musty smell or some water damage then you should get an inspection a lot sooner than that.
2.What happens if mold is found during the inspection?
When this happens, the inspector will explain the problem and give you suggestions on how to get rid of it. In some cases, it will need to be professionally removed.
3. Can I do my own mold inspection?
Sure, you can look for mold, but trained inspectors look for hidden mold and evaluate the problem. They have the necessary tools and experience to uncover mold that you may overlook.
4. Is mold testing necessary?
Mold testing is required when hidden mold or mold impacting the air quality is suspected. A visual inspection and moisture evaluation are sufficient for a large number of situations.
5. How much time is required for a mold inspection?
Most mold inspections only take about 1 to 2 hours. The time can increase or decrease based on the size of the structure as well as the complexities of the inspection.
6. How do I stop mold from growing in my home?
To stop the growth of mold in your home, fix leaks, keep areas of your home well ventilated, and use a dehumidifier in moisture-heavy areas (like basements and bathrooms. Also, periodically checking your home can help you catch moisture problems before they become big issues.
